The plastic panels on my JD 4400 are truly pathetic. Many of them have broken at least once, and I keep gluing them together. Just before I bought it, a mechanic from the JD dealer worked on it and dropped the hood. It broke and he had to replace it. I should admit that I do a lot of work in the woods and push brush piles and move brush with a grapple, so there are a lot of branches around to hit the tractor. I made a brush guard for the radiator grille. But steel panels would definitely fare much better.

The plastic panels on my JD 4400 are truly pathetic. I made a brush guard for the radiator grille.
I built a brush guard,, or should I say I adapted a brush guard to my tractor.
When I bought my JD, the dealer was swapping the guard on an 85HP tractor, that an employee had dented,,
I asked If I could have the dented one, they delivered it when they delivered the tractor,,

Four pieces of steel, and a few bolts later,,

KB3QAed.jpg


The guard even flips down with the pull of a pin, but, it is so big, I can raise the hood without flipping the guard.
